Kolisi bids Kings Park farewell with a brace as youth-laden Sharks demolish Zebre
A youth-heavy Sharks side beat Zebre 54-19 in their URC season finale at Kings Park, with Siya Kolisi scoring twice in his farewell appearance before returning to the Stormers, while debutant flyhalf Vusi Moyo and fullback Zekhethelu Siyaya further pressed their cases.
Kolisi bows out with a brace as Sharks thrash Zebre 54-19 in URC finale
Siya Kolisi scored twice in his final Sharks appearance as the franchise ended their URC season with a commanding 54-19 win over Zebre Parma in Durban, with André Esterhuizen dominant in the carry and teenage debutant fly-half Simphiwe Vusi Moyo contributing 15 points.
